Design and Fabrication of Single Speed Double


Reduction Gearbox of Baja vehicle
1
Kaushal Sankhe, 2Swapnil Kuwar, 3Prof. A. R. Suware
1, 2,3
Dept of Mechanical Engineering, RMCET / Mumbai University, India

Abstract : This report is about design, fabrication of Baja SAE ATV(All Terrain Vehicle) drive train.Baja SAE is an
intercollegiate engineering design competition for undergraduate and graduate engineering students. As we know the
participation of students in SAE Baja competition is increasing year by year.The object of the competition is to simulate
real-world engineering design projects and their related challenges. Each team is competing to have its design accepted
for manufacture by a fictitious firm. The students must function as a team to design, engineer, build, test, promote and
compete with a vehicle within the limits of the rules. Calculations are done with respect to required maximum torque
and maximum speed. Our transmission system is assembly of CVT (continuous variable transmission) and single speed
gear box.

2.3.1 Gear Material
gueCVTechAAB_US_%202013.pdf
The material that we are using is EN8 Medium Carbon
[2] Design of a Drivetrain for Sae Baja Racing Off Road
Steel which is readily machinable in any condition. It is a
Vehicle [Vol-1, Issue-4, July- 2015] ISSN: 2454-1311
medium strength steel and has good tensile strength.
[3] Briggs & Stratton M19H 10.0 HP Net Torque Ref.
EN8 is suitable for the manufacturing of parts such as gear,
briggsracing.com/default/files
shaft, keys etc. it can be further surface hardened by
induction processes, producing components with enhance
were resistance.
Max Stress is around 700-850 N/mm2
Yield Stress is 465 N/mm2
Chemical composition:-
Carbon 0.36-0.44 %
Silicon 0.10-0.40 %
Manganese 0.60-1.00 %
Sulphur 0.050 Max
Phosphorus 0.050 Max

2.3.2. Casing Material


Casing material that we are using is 6061 aluminum. This
will help in weight reduction. This alloy is part of the 6000
series of alloy. As such, its major alloying elements are
magnesium and silicon .magnesium is added to increase
strength, while the silicon is added to reduce the metal
melting temperature.
Tensile Strength 241 N/mm2
Yield Strength 145 N/mm2
Chemical composition:-
Magnesium 1.2 %
Silicon 0.8 %
Copper 0.4 %
Chromium 0.35 %
